Front Door With Window: A Comprehensive Guide
When it pertains to enhancing the curb appeal and functionality of a home, the option of a front door considerably affects the general aesthetic. One popular choice that house owners frequently consider is the front door with a window. This short article supplies an in-depth exploration of front doors featuring windows, detailing their benefits, style options, products, and considerations for setup.
Understanding Front Doors with Windows
Front doors with windows been available in various styles and products, providing an outstanding combination of aesthetic appeals and functionality. These doors usually feature glass panels that can be designed in different sizes, shapes, and styles, allowing natural light to light up the entranceway while offering a clear view of the outside.
Advantages of Front Doors with Windows
Picking a front door with a window provides numerous advantages:
- Natural Light: The primary benefit is the influx of natural light. This can make the entrance brilliant and welcoming.
- Exposure: Windows in front doors typically provide visibility to the outdoors world, enhancing awareness of visitors before opening the door.
- Visual Appeal: A front door with a window can function as a declaration piece, include character to your home, and complement the total architectural design.
- Air flow: Some styles permit for ventilation, improving airflow in the entrance.
- Security Features: Modern front doors with windows often include tempered glass or other security features to hinder break-ins.

Products Used in Front Doors with Windows
When thinking about a front door with a window, the product is vital for sturdiness, insulation, and upkeep. Here are some frequently used materials:
1. Fiberglass
- Extremely suggested due to energy efficiency.
- Resistant to warping and can simulate the look of wood.
- Low upkeep requirements.
2. Wood
- Offers traditional appeal and heat.
- Requires routine upkeep (staining or painting) to prevent weather condition damage.
- Various types of wood can supply special looks.
3. Steel
- Provides high security and durability.
- More resistant to effect than wood or fiberglass.
- Limited design versatility however can be customized.
4. click for more Vinyl
- Economical and energy-efficient.
- Low maintenance and readily available in many designs.
- Usually, not as visually appealing as wood or fiberglass.
Table: Comparison of Front Door Materials
Material | Toughness | Maintenance | Cost | Insulation Efficiency | Visual Appeal |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Fiberglass | High | Low | Moderate | Outstanding | Flexible |
Wood | Moderate | High | High | Moderate | High |
Steel | High | Low | Moderate | Moderate | Moderate |
Vinyl | Moderate | Low | Low | Excellent | Moderate |
Installation Considerations
When setting up a front door with a window, a number of aspects must be considered:
- Professional vs. DIY: While some homeowners may select a DIY setup, working with a professional guarantees that the door is correctly fitted and sealed, avoiding drafts or leakages.
- Regulatory Guidelines: Compliance with local building regulations regarding glass installation is vital for security.
- Weather Stripping: Ensure correct weather stripping is used around the door to improve energy efficiency.
- Security Measures: Choose doors with protected locks and think about enhancing windows with laminated glass or ornamental grilles.
- Upkeep Plan: Depending on the material selected, an upkeep plan must be developed to preserve the door's condition and appearance.
Frequently asked questions
1. Are front doors with windows more pricey than solid doors?
- Normally, front doors with windows can be more pricey due to the additional materials and style complexity. However, expense differs commonly based on the material and manufacturer.
2. How do I clean the glass on my front door?
- Use a soft cloth and a quality glass cleaner. Avoid abrasive products that may scratch the glass surface area.
3. Can I replace a strong door with a door that has windows?
- Yes, replacing a strong door with a front door with windows is possible, however structural modifications may be needed.
4. Do front doors with windows offer enough security?
- Modern doors with windows are created with security in mind. Look for tempered glass alternatives and robust locking systems to improve security.
